Kosovo's highest court has temporarily prohibited President Vjosa Osmani from setting a date for a snap election until March 31, extending the political crisis in the country.
The Constitutional Court has imposed a temporary measure prohibiting the President and the Assembly from taking any action until March 31, following President Osmani's decree dissolving the parliament.
